Louisiana Politicians React to U.S. Military Strikes in Iran
Following President Donald Trump’s announcement of U.S. military strikes targeting Iranian sites, Louisiana politicians expressed a range of reactions reflecting both support and concern over the actions taken.
Governor Jeff Landry lauded the strike as a demonstration of strength, echoing sentiments that peace is achieved through assertive military action. He thanked the armed forces for their efforts and extended his support to Trump, recognizing the president’s commitment to national security.
Speaker of the U.S. House of Representatives, Mike Johnson, supported the president’s decision, emphasizing the urgency of addressing Iran as a state sponsor of terrorism. He argued that Trump’s actions were necessary and aligned with historical precedent from previous administrations.
Majority Leader Steve Scalise reiterated support for Trump’s stance against Iran’s nuclear ambitions, framing the strikes as a direct response to Iranian threats. He maintained that the U.S. must act decisively in the face of such dangers.
Conversely, Congressman Troy Carter voiced strong opposition to the unilateral military action, arguing it bypassed Congressional authority to declare war. He called for measured diplomacy rather than escalation, urging adherence to constitutional principles in matters of international conflict.
Congressman Cleo Fields expressed concern over U.S. involvement in the Iran-Israel conflict, advocating for prioritizing diplomacy to address domestic issues rather than engaging in what he described as another potential endless conflict.
While Attorney General Liz Murrill echoed Landry’s sentiments of "peace through strength," the mixed responses reflect a broader debate on the balance between swift military action and the need for Congressional oversight in matters of war. As tensions continue, Louisiana’s political landscape remains divided on the best path forward for U.S. engagement with Iran.
